This website is hosted by Microsoft and provides information
on the Open Systems Interconnect (OSI) Model.
The article describes and explains the seven layers of the OSI Model
beginning with the lowest layer in the hierarchy (physical) and proceeds to the
highest layer (application). The article
is easy to follow because a lot of text is not used and a bulleted list format
is incorporated into the article. The
bullets list the functions of each OSI layer.
